A NEW boxing club has opened in Tottenham at the Selby Centre, a charity which develops the community in a deprived area. The club has converted a derelict hall into a spacious gym with new equipment thanks to significant support from the Sport England Small Grant fund, as well as Sported and Sportivate.
Olympic gold medallist James DeGale, his trainer Jim McDonnell, a former world title challenger himself, and former English champion Ashley Sexton opened the new gym on February 13 at a lively, well-attended ceremony.
